About Verica Risovic

Verica Risovic is a scholar working on Infectious Diseases, Pediatrics, Perinatology and Child Health, Pharmaceutical Science, Oncology and Food Science, having authored 13 papers that have together received 432 indexed citations. Recurring topics across this work include Antifungal resistance and susceptibility (3 papers), Pharmaceutical studies and practices (3 papers), Essential Oils and Antimicrobial Activity (3 papers), Antibiotics Pharmacokinetics and Efficacy (2 papers), Advanced Drug Delivery Systems (2 papers), Helminth infection and control (2 papers), Drug Transport and Resistance Mechanisms (2 papers) and Drug Solubulity and Delivery Systems (1 paper). The work is most often cited by research in Pharmaceutical Science (159 citations), Biomaterials (98 citations), Infectious Diseases (73 citations), Oncology (80 citations) and Small Animals (20 citations). Verica Risovic has collaborated with scholars based in Canada, Finland and Japan. Frequent co-authors include Kishor M. Wasan, Michael Boyd, Eugene Choo, Manisha Ramaswamy, B. Lundberg, John K. Jackson, Weixian Min, Helen M. Burt, Olena Sivak and Kristina Sachs‐Barrable. Their work appears in journals such as Journal of Pharmaceutical Sciences, Antimicrobial Agents and Chemotherapy, Biomaterials, Pharmaceutical Research and Journal of Trace Elements in Medicine and Biology.
